Compliance & Documentation Requirements
- Background Checks:
- 7-year criminal background check within 90 days of start, updated annually
- EPLS/GSA/SAM, HHS/OIG checks required within 30 days of start and updated monthly
- Sex offender search within 30 days of start, updated monthly
- Education Verification: Primary or third-party verification of highest education level required (not applicable if state license held)
- Competency Exam: Specialty-specific exam required annually, minimum 80% score
- Health Documents:
- Physical exam within 12 months indicating good health
- Negative TB test or chest X-ray within 12 months, updated annually
- Immunizations or titers for Rubeola (Measles), Mumps, Rubella, Hepatitis B, Varicella
- Tdap vaccination required for select departments
- Negative 10-panel drug screen within 60 days of start, updated annually
- Seasonal flu vaccination or approved exemption required during flu season (Oct 1 – Apr 30)
- Fit Mask Testing: Annual fit test required; can be completed onsite if needed
- Photo for Badge: Recent full-color passport-style photo required within 24 hours of booking

About New Orleans, LA
As a Travel Registered Respiratory Therapist in New Orleans, LA here's what you should know:Cost of Living
- New Orleans' cost of living is slightly lower than the national average.
- Wages may not fully match the lower cost of living, but the overall affordability is favorable for many.
Weather
- Average summer highs range from 89°F to 92°F, while winter lows range from 45°F to 47°F.
Furnished Housing
- Short term rentals are readily available in New Orleans, especially in popular areas like the French Quarter and Garden District.
Transportation
- New Orleans is fairly car-friendly, but public transportation options include buses and streetcars, which are convenient for getting around the city.
Demographics
- New Orleans is a diverse city with a mix of African, French, and American influences.
- The age range is varied, and common health issues may include obesity and cardiovascular diseases.
- There is a large population of travel nurses due to the city's vibrant healthcare industry.
Things to Do
- New Orleans is known for its vibrant restaurant scene, live music, and rich cultural heritage.
- Visitors can enjoy iconic foods like gumbo and po'boys, explore art galleries and live music venues, and participate in outdoor activities along the Mississippi River.
